What would you do? Transforming sales to become a future-ready and digital B2B revenue engine. Sales Support resource is responsible for providing administrative and analytical support to the sales team, primarily focused on maximizing revenue generation by managing customer accounts, processing orders, generating reports, and ensuring smooth customer interactions, requiring strong communication, organizational skills, and proficiency with CRM systems to achieve sales targets. Equip sales teams with the right content, training, and data to drive sales activity.

Roles and Responsibilities: •"Role Summary The Sales Effectiveness Specialist supports sales enablement by creating, maintaining, and governing sales content, messaging, and process frameworks aligned to buyer personas and sales stages, ensuring sellers have access to standardized, high-quality assets, documentation, and enablement support to drive adoption and effectiveness. Key Accountabilities • Create and maintain sales content, messaging, stage-based guidance, CTAs, and play frameworks aligned to buyer personas and sales stages. • Draft sales assets using approved templates and inputs from Sales and Marketing teams. • Update messaging and content based on defined changes, campaign updates, and business requirements. • Perform quality checks to ensure content accuracy, formatting consistency, and usability. • Apply version control standards including naming conventions and content lifecycle management. • Publish and manage content in centralized repositories ensuring accessibility and governance. • Document sales processes, workflows, and procedures in standardized formats. • Update SOPs based on approved changes and evolving business requirements. • Maintain structured process libraries and repositories for content and documentation. • Apply audit controls by tracking changes and maintaining version history. • Distribute updated SOPs and content to relevant stakeholders. • Coordinate enablement sessions including scheduling, logistics, and communication. • Prepare training materials such as guides, decks, and walkthroughs aligned to enablement programs. • Track training completion, attendance, and participation metrics. • Monitor post-training adoption through tool usage, content access, and activity data. • Report enablement effectiveness and adoption insights to stakeholders. " "• Hands-on expertise with sales technology platforms (Highspot, Outreach, LinkedIn Sales Navigator, ZoomInfo, CRM). • Experience in platform administration, user access management, and permission controls. • Ability to support CRM workflows, automation, and process configurations. • Strong knowledge of content governance, taxonomy structuring, and lifecycle management. • Capability in operational quality assurance and pre-launch validation of assets and workflows. • Experience in reporting support, dashboard generation, and ensuring data accuracy. • Proficiency in training operations, SOP development, and process documentation. • Ability to manage structured intake processes and track issue resolution. • Strong presentation and deck creation skills for sales and enablement materials.
